    Although I do not live on the North Shore, I visit often, as my in-laws moved there a few years ago. On Sunday, 30 JUL 2023, I was attending my godchild's birthday party and 9 of my family members (including my family) wanted to grab a quick bite to eat. A Yelp search showed that Times Grill was only 1.2 miles from our location, so we decided to give it a try, as none of us had ever eaten there before. The moment we walked through the door, there was no mistaking that you were in a burger restaurant, as it totally smelled like burgers cooking. We were seated fairly quickly, and our server arrived shortly thereafter. As we had just left a party, we did not get any appetizers, as we all had eaten a few snacks at the party. Seven out of the nine of us got burgers, as Times is apparently known for their burgers. Having so many choices, I was initially undecided on what burger to get, but eventually settled on the "All Jacked Up" burger, which is an 8 oz. burger topped with sautéed onions and "jacked up" Pepper Jack cheese. I also added a fried egg on the burger, which really was the perfect topper. It was good to see that they didn't skimp on the cheese, because it looked like 2-3 slices of melted gooey goodness. I like medium rare burgers, but usually order medium, as I find a lot of restaurants tend to undercook their steaks and burgers. Times was no exception, as my burger came out perfectly medium rare, so beware when ordering. When getting a burger, your one side item options are French fries, Times potato salad and creole Cole Slaw. I almost never get French Fries, so opted for the potato salad, as my wife was getting the Cole Slaw and I knew I'd get to try hers. The potato salad was good and it didn't have too much mayonnaise. It was a little on the spicy side, which I like, but I think most people would prefer a more subdued "less spic / normal" offering. The Cole Slaw was definitely on point and not soggy at all. Our server, who's name escapes me, was good. She checked on us periodically, split our checks into 4 separate parties and gave us drinks to go. Other than my undercooked burger, and a little bit of a "smoky" atmosphere, it was a solid restaurant.
